# 历史版本记录

# 0.4.1 非发布版

  • 更新开发文档友情链接
  • 优化页脚组件展示效果

# 0.4.0

  • 完成 随机马赛克头像组件 的封装
  • 更新开发文档部分示例说明,方便新手使用
  • 优化文档站点左侧导航访问体验

# 0.3.8 非发布版

  • 开发文档站点添加一键回顶插件
  • 开发文档站点添加页面跟随侧边栏滚动插件
  • 开发文档站点添加进度条插件
  • 开发文档搜索框默认配置修改

# 0.3.7

  • 修复阴阳形状组件默认颜色的问题
  • 集成fx67llClock组件库的 二进制时钟组件
  • 完善开发文档中的说明文件

# 0.3.6

  • 修复README.md文件在npm主页不显示的问题,是因为文件有不可以超过140行的限制
  • 0.3.30.3.40.3.5版本没有修复,这些版本都是废弃版本
  • 完善开发文档中的说明文件

# 0.3.2

  • 开发文档添加示例演示插件
  • 修复进度条组件参数校验异常的问题
  • 进度条组件添加是否显示提示文本的参数

# 0.3.1 非发布版

# 0.3.0 非发布版

  • 使用vuepress构建开发文档站点
  • 开发文档站点继续完善
    • 需要注意的是!!! 目前如果直接使用npm install安装之后进行自动化构建
    • 可能会出现vue-server-renderer版本与vue@2.6.10不一致的报错
    • 所以暂时使用本地构建,上传dist,自动覆盖更新的策略处理
    • 完整的自动化流程待后续解决这个问题再使用
    • 本地解决报错的方案:需要强制指定版本为vue-server-renderer@2.6.10来解决冲突问题
  • 开启新一轮组件封装,用于部分个人站点的效果提升

# 0.2.22

  • 修复21版本包提交失败问题,0.2.21版本为废弃版本
  • 修复加载进度条组件百分百之后隐藏异常的问题
  • 删除不必要中文字体包文件

# 0.2.20

  • 修复加载进度条组件当前进度百分比为零会验证参数异常的问题

# 0.2.19

  • 修复页脚组件网站作者主页字段验证错误问题
  • 修复加载进度条组件加载完成后不隐藏加载页面的问题

# 0.2.18

  • 修复16/17版本包提交失败问题,0.2.160.2.17版本均为废弃版本,请在0.2.18版本中使用上述两个新组件
  • 完成 网站页脚组件 的封装,可以设置字体颜色、a标签悬浮颜色、z-index、网站作者名称、网站作者主页、网站开始运营年份、网站备案号
  • 完成 加载进度条组件 的封装,可以设置当前进度百分比、加载是否已完成、进度条样式种类、z-index、背景颜色、提示文字颜色、条纹颜色一、条纹颜色二、渐变颜色一、渐变颜色二、单次动画时间
  • 添加less中动画的封装,现已支持在less中直接使用animation,定义keyframe的方式稍稍有点区别,示例如下:
.keyframes(all, animationName, {
		from {
			width: 0%;
		}

		to {
			width: 100%;
		}
	}
);

# 0.2.15

  • 完成纯CSS3绘制的 聊天框 组件的封装,可以设置 聊天框 组件的颜色和大小,以及传入聊天框宽度、简易的文字内容和文字颜色
  • 后期考虑 丰富 聊天框 组件的用途,并用考虑如何用正则验证传入的宽度格式
  • 后续版本 一键回顶组件
  • 远期版本 右键菜单组件

# 0.2.14

  • 完成纯CSS3绘制的 六角星符号 组件的封装,可以设置 六角星 的颜色和大小

# 0.2.13

  • 完成纯CSS3绘制的 月亮符号 组件的封装,可以设置 月亮 的颜色和大小

# 0.2.12

  • 完成纯CSS3绘制的 十字架符号 组件的封装,可以设置 十字架 的颜色和大小

# 0.2.11

  • 完成纯CSS3绘制的 阴阳 组件的封装,可以设置 阴阳 的颜色和大小

# 0.2.10

  • 完成纯CSS3绘制的 钻石符号 组件的封装,可以设置 钻石 的颜色和大小

# 0.2.9

  • 完成纯CSS3绘制的 吃豆人 组件的封装,可以设置 吃豆人 的颜色和大小

# 0.2.8

  • 完成纯CSS3绘制的 鸡蛋符号 组件的封装,可以设置 鸡蛋符号 的颜色和大小

# 0.2.7

  • 完成纯CSS3绘制的 太空入侵者 组件的封装,可以设置 太空入侵者 的颜色和大小

# 0.2.6

  • 完成纯CSS3绘制的 爱心符号 组件的封装,可以设置 爱心 的颜色和大小

# 0.2.5

  • 后续的话功能过于复杂,且能够独立发挥较大作用的的组件单独提供,简单的或者个人使用的特殊组件继续在本组件库中整合
  • 完成纯CSS3绘制的 三角形符号 组件的封装,可以设置 三角形 的指向,颜色和大小

# 0.2.4

  • 综合考虑下,该控件整合自己写过的所有控件,暂不提供按需加载的功能
  • 不过某些比较有意思的控件仍然在npm上提供单独下载

# 0.2.3

  • 修复文档错误

# 0.2.2

  • 完成一次注册使用多个组件
  • 0.2.2版本之前不支持一次注册使用多个组件

# 0.2.1

  • 完成纯CSS3绘制的 五角星符号 组件的封装,可以设置 五角星 的颜色和大小

# 0.2.0

  • 去除不必要的依赖,减少安装时间
  • 添加MIT的软件使用许可证

# 0.1.1

  • 完成纯CSS3绘制的 无限符号 组件的封装,可以设置 无限 的颜色以及大小
  • 测试单组件发布到npm上的全流程

# 0.1.0

  • 模仿elementui的组件库做一个自己的vue组件库
  • 同时用于练习在npm上面发包
  • 锻炼自己制作复杂公共vue组件的能力,为个人项目提供方便
  • 自己写的性能肯定没法和主流的组件库媲美,我对自己的要求是先模仿一些基础的功能,再力求每个组件上能有一些不同的独特的功能点
Last Updated: 2023/7/21 上午9:49:17